Egypt: The calm before the storm

Camels on the market in Birqash

Today is a quiet day at the camel market in Birqash. No trading is taking place. The camels can recover from the strain of the long transport from Sudan to the north of Egypt. Finally, they can eat and drink in peace, finally they are free of their shackles and can move around. But the peace will only last a day. Most of the animals will be sold to slaughterhouses around Cairo tomorrow and the camels' suffering will reach its peak. Our team on the ground will not be able to do anything about this. They cannot stop the trade and the slaughter of the animals, but they are there to stand up for the dignity of the camels and to ensure that they are treated with respect.
